Output e9fac63152ed2ecdbde72c8b20ecea297e3c0d6b375d3398329545739c2c95ec:1

value
126656889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5d0ee5fc845992bf8042211009a1ab01f5d7321 OP_EQUAL
address
3NeAxGFB1maiUNj2H443Qp3bZTnzT7EsXS
transaction
e9fac63152ed2ecdbde72c8b20ecea297e3c0d6b375d3398329545739c2c95ec
confirmations
481388
spent
true